What is a Perm Hairstyle for Men?
A perm, short for perming, is a chemical hair treatment that creates waves or curls by altering the hair’s structural proteins. For men, perming offers a refined alternative to short, rigid styles — delivering volume, movement, and sun-kissed waves that enhance facial features without sacrificing professionalism.

Best Perm Hairstyles for Guys
1. Loose Beach Waves
Soft, undulating waves that mimic a natural coastal vibe are perfect for addition of volume with minimal effort. Ideal for thick, coarse textures, this perm style creates a relaxed yet sharp edge — great for professional settings or lazy weekends.

2. Tight Coil Perm
For those who love texture and edge, a tight coil perm delivers voluminous, springy curls that hold shape all day. Best suited to finer hair that responds well to ring curls or spiral extensions, this style commands attention without being overdone.
3. Finger-Curled Perm
Consistently popular, finger-curled perms offer a natural, hand-shaped wave with excellent definition. The technique requires precision and skills but results in lush, layered curls that frame the face beautifully.

How to Choose the Right Perm Style
- Hair Type: Porous, wavy, or coarse hair often responds best to ring curls or tight coils; finer hair benefits from loose, airier textures.
- Face Shape: Round or square faces benefit from deep waves that soften angles; angular faces suit tighter coils or structured curls.
- Lifestyle & Maintenance: Consider how much time you want to spend styling. Tight coils may need more heat or control products, while loose waves offer effortless living.
The Perming Process: What to Expect
Professional perming involves swelling the hair fiber with alkaline solutions, followed by neutralization with vinegar-based products to set the wave pattern. Modern techniques use advanced heat and application methods for improved comfort and curl retention. Aftercare—like deep moisturizing and avoiding tight styles—is essential to preserve your perm’s integrity.
